DESCRIPTION:Dr. Karen Majewski\nPresident\, Polish American Historical Association (PAHA)\nAttend it on Zoom:  https://us06web.zoom.us/j/88265554551?pwd=tjGo9dnlZeb1qhsWfBdvpmzA1r90ZK.1&from=addon\n\nOur Polish Ancestors and the Written Word will dispel the myth that Polish immigrants were illiterate and uninterested in reading and writing. Focusing on the late 19th century through the 1930s\, we will look at the wide variety of reading material being created and consumed in the Polish American community\, including religious materials\, newspapers\, and literature written in Poland and the United States\, including translations and original works. We will pay special attention to the publishing companies that served the Polish American community and to the writing produced by the immigrants themselves chronicling and interpreting their experiences in the United States.

DESCRIPTION:Story of Wiktoria and Franek: How Did Solidarity Come into Being? \nHistoria Wiktorii i Franka: Jak Powstała Solidarność? \n\nThe play transports the audience to the turbulent times of Solidarity’s rise and the August 1980 strikes. The story of the union’s formation is presented from the perspective of two ten-year-olds: Wiktoria\, who lives in Gdańsk in 1981\, and Franek\, who travels from the 21st century straight into the heart of these historic events. Through his journey back in time\, Franek has the chance to witness firsthand what he had only heard about in his grandmother’s stories. \nWhat sets this play apart is its interactivity. The children in the audience are not just passive observers—they become part of events that took place more than forty years ago. The actors portraying Wiktoria and Franek actively engage the young audience by asking questions and encouraging them to find solutions together. \nThis performance is not just a history lesson; it is an exciting journey through time—one that will surely leave a lasting impression and inspire curiosity about the past. \nThe play is performed in Polish and is intended for young viewers\, but it is open to all. \nProduced by the Polish Institute of National Remembrance\, the play is presented by the Polish American Cultural Institute of Minnesota in cooperation with the Adam Mickiewicz Polish Saturday School in Minneapolis. \nFollowing the performance\, a post-show reception will take place in the Chief Justice Room (430)\, offering an opportunity to continue the conversation and reflect on the evening. DESCRIPTION:Basia Bułat is a Canadian folk singer-songwriter of Polish origin and a proud member of Canadian Polonia (Polish diaspora). \nHer distinctive voice and artistry blend elements of R&B and soul with freak folk\, creating a sound that is both unique and emotionally resonant. Her talent has been recognized on a grand scale—her songs have been adapted for major symphony orchestra performances\, and she has been invited to perform at prestigious tributes to Leonard Cohen\, Daniel Lanois\, and The Band. \nSince her debut in 2007\, she has shared the stage with artists such as The National\, Nick Cave and the Bad Seeds\, Daniel Lanois\, St. Vincent\, Sufjan Stevens\, and Destroyer. As a versatile songwriter\, she has collaborated across genres with artists like US Girls and Jeremy Dutcher. In addition to her powerful voice\, Bułat is a skilled multi-instrumentalist\, performing and recording on electric guitar\, piano\, autoharp\, ukulele\, bass\, and charango. \nBasia will be celebrating the release of her new album\, Basia’s Palace. On it\, she features Disco Polo\, a folk song named for a genre of Polish dance music that her late father loved. The song reflects the duality of her musical inheritance. “This is an homage to what I feel are the two sides of my musical lineage—my mother was a classically trained piano and guitar teacher\, and my father’s favorite genre was Disco Polo.” \nPACIM members receive a special Buy One Get One deal (Thursday\, March 13\, 9:00 AM while supplies last by using code POLONIA. \n🎟️ For more information and tickets\, visit: \n🔗 https://www.thecedar.org/events/basia-bulat-basias-palace-live-in-concert

DESCRIPTION:Anthony Bukoski\, The Thief of Words \nFrom University of Wisconsin Press: “The Thief of Words is filled with desperate runaways\, the unhappily married\, and the displaced. These characters often long for happiness but struggle to explain—even to themselves—what that would entail. \nThe lightly interconnected stories in this riveting collection are split between the Polish American communities of northern Wisconsin and Louisiana\, where refugees from World War II were resettled. Exploring themes of dislocation and assimilation\, love and loneliness\, and generational conflict\, Anthony Bukoski admirably paints portraits of people doing their best\, despite the odds and their sometimes-thwarted attempts to follow the urgings of their better angels.” \nFor forty-one years\, Anthony Bukoski has written short stories about Polish Americans in northern Wisconsin. In the program\, he will tell why he began doing this and how he has been inspired to continue. Though understanding that the stories may be flawed\, he has been loyal to his subject\, never straying from it. He will read very brief passages from a few of the stories and conclude by reading “A Sea Story” from The Thief of Words. \nA discussion will follow. \nHe will be pleased to sign books afterward. \nAnthony Bukoski was born and raised in Superior\, Wisconsin\, the port city where his Polish immigrant grandparents settled. The author’s short story collections have twice won the Polish American Historical Association’s Creative Arts Award and once its Oskar Halecki Prize. The Sarmatian Review\, under the aegis of the Polish Institute of Houston\, also recognized Bukoski with its first Literary Award “for excellence in presenting the life of American Polish communities in the Midwest.”

DESCRIPTION:As part of their annual French film festival\, Lumières Françaises (July 11–17)\, the MSP Film Society and The Main Cinema will present a special screening of Three Colors: Blue\, directed by legendary Polish filmmaker Krzysztof Kieślowski. \nBlue (Trois Couleurs: Bleu) is the first film in the internationally acclaimed Three Colors trilogy. Though set in Paris and spoken in French\, its soul is unmistakably Polish—deeply reflective\, poetic\, and emotionally profound. The story follows a woman grappling with unimaginable personal loss as she searches for freedom and meaning—a theme deeply resonant with the Polish experience. \nKieślowski\, known in Poland for such masterpieces as Dekalog and The Double Life of Veronique\, brought his unique sensibility to this European co-production\, earning worldwide recognition while remaining firmly rooted in the Polish tradition of thoughtful\, symbolic cinema. \nWe warmly invite PACIM members and friends to join us in celebrating one of Poland’s greatest cinematic voices and to experience this moving work of art together. \nTICKETS 👉 https://mspfilm.org/show/certified-binoche-three-colors-blue/ \nPACIM members and friends can use the code PACIMLF25 to receive a ticket discount for the screening of Blue or any other film presented during Lumières Françaises. \nYou can find the full program for Lumières Françaises at: \n👉 https://mspfilm.org/series/lumieres-francaises/ \nCertified Binoche!
